Table 2.
First recurrent suicidal behaviour (attempted suicide or dying by suicide) of Axis I group. The primary and secondary outcome measures were the incidence proportion of the first episode of recurrent suicidal behaviour (attempted suicide or dying by suicide) at 6 and 12 months after randomisation, respectively
Primary outcome 6 months (n = 734) |
Secondary outcome 12 months (n = 692) |
|
---|---|---|
Intervention vs control | 21/354 vs 44/380 | 35/338 vs 50/354 |
Unadjusted risk ratio | 0.51 (0.31–0.84), P = 0.009 | 0.73 (0.49–1.10), P = 0.133 |
(Imputed missing data) * | 0.49 (0.30–0.81), P = 0.005 | 0.72 (0.48–1.08), P = 0.112 |
Adjusted risk ratio + | 0.53 (0.32–0.87), P = 0.012 | 0.75 (0.50–1.12), P = 0.156 |
(Imputed missing data) § | 0.52 (0.32–0.86), P = 0.010 * | 0.72 (0.48–1.08), P = 0.110 |
*age and sex adjusted
The data included the number of events/population for the intervention participants (assertive case management) or for the control participants (enhanced usual care), or the risk ratio (95% CI). *Risk ratios with data imputed for individuals who missed the assessment. +Risk ratios adjusted by use of regression models for the randomisation factors of sex, age, and history of previous suicide attempts before the current episode. §Risk ratios with data imputed for individuals who missed the assessment and adjusted by use of regression models for the randomisation factors of sex, age, and history of previous suicide attempts before the current episode
